I also managed to gain
access to the Senate of the Philippines. Senate is the upper house of
Parliament here and is currently in recess due to elections. The Senate building
is located next to the GSIS (Government Social Insurance System) and the Senate
actually rent that part of the building from the GSIS.
Whilst at the GSIS it
was arranged that I went next door through the two heads of security. The
Senate Chamber is actually quite small as it only has 24 Senators for the whole
country. They sit behind actual desks so it is rather like being in a school
room.
